Immerse yourself in the world of Liesel Meminger, a young girl living in Nazi Germany, in "The Book Thief" by Markus Zusak. Follow her journey as she discovers the power of words and literature amidst the chaos of war. It was published by Random House Children's Books in 2007. The story explores themes of death and dying, the Holocaust, family and foster homes, and the importance of books and libraries.
